Algoritma Perulangan dalam C++
Algoritma
Perulangan dalam C++
Perulangan adalah suatu proses
eksekusi statemen-statemen dalam sebuah program secara terus-menerus sampai
terdapat kondisi untuk menghentikannya. Operasi perulangan / looping selalu
dijumpai didalam berbagai bahasa pemrograman, hal tersebut karena struktur
perulangan akan sangat membantu dalam efisiensi program.
Terdapat dua
bagian:
a. Kondisi
perulangan: Kondisi yang
harus dipenuhi untuk melakukan perulangan
b. Isi/badan
perulangan: Satu atau lebih
pernyataan yang akan diulang
Notasi yang
dapat digunakan:
1. While
Struktur perulangan while adalah perulangan yang melakukan
pemeriksaan kondisi di awal blok perulangan. Kita tahu bahwa perulangan hanya
akan dilakukan jika kondisi yang didefinisikan terpenuhi (jika kondisi bernilai
benar). Hal ini berarti jika kondisi yang didefinisikan tidak terpenuhi
(bernilai salah) maka statemen-statemen yang terdapat dalam blok perulangan pun
tidak akan pernah dieksekusi oleh program.
Bentuk umum:2. Do-While
Berbeda dengan struktur while yang melakukan pemeriksaan
kondisi di awal blok perulangan, pada struktur do-while kondisi justru
ditempatkan di bagian akhir. Hal ini tentu menyebabkan struktur perulangan
do-while minimal akan melakukan satu kali proses eksekusi statemen yang akan
diulang walaupan kondisi yang didefinisikan tidak terpenuhi (bernilai salah).
Bentuk umum:3. For
Struktur
perulangan / pengulangan jenis for biasanya digunakan untuk melakukan
perulangan yang telah diketahui banyaknya. Biasanya jenis perulangan for dianggap
sebagai jenis perulangan yang paling mudah dipahami.
Bentuk umum:Sumber:
Komentar
Posting Komentar